There are no good reasons to stay in. I opposed joining the Common Market in 1973 (and voted against it in 1975) because it was clear even then that the EU was designed to be a federalist state specifically designed to make it easier for the corporate rich to exploit the working classes of member countries. Back in 1973, most of the Labour Party (in those days it still contained some socialists) were rightly opposed to the Common Market. Unfortunately most of them have now been seduced by faux internationalism and identity politics and have forgotten the reason why their party exists - and in that I include the ultra-liberal Corbyn.
